Transaction 81f2a39248c085e6919512280ddfb71eec9be5b3c1aa84f6d7fb4ff2cec42b96
1 Input
1 Output
-
81f2a39248c085e6919512280ddfb71eec9be5b3c1aa84f6d7fb4ff2cec42b96:0
- value
- 32657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c6cd59c05044cdc5285dbcd125428e495fbe652 OP_EQUAL
- address
- 3JsKLZAZVpzhtm67juvvrBVE1zeZdrbQ1q